P.A.F. Junior – South Africa’s First Production Gun

January 29, 2019 Ian McCollum 14
The Pretoria Arms Factory was founded in 1954 by Piet Nagel and Jan Willem Dekker. both Dutch immigrants to South Africa after WW2. They began manufacturing a simplified copy of the Baby Browning pocket pistol, […]

H&K G41: The HK33 Meets the M16

January 25, 2019 Ian McCollum 34
The H&K G41 was developed for the NATO trials of the early 1980s, which were set up to look at both rifles and cartridges for NATO standardization (although they did not end up choosing a […]

Paramax: Final Iteration of the LDP Kommando

January 23, 2019 Ian McCollum 54
The Kommando semiauto carbine was designed in 1975 by Alexis du Plessis in Rhodesia, and went on the be manufactured in South Africa a few years later by the Maxim Parabellum company. The final iteration […]

Ammunition Evaluation: 1941 Turkish 8mm Mauser

January 22, 2019 Ian McCollum 27
Turkey adopted the 8mm Mauser cartridge as part of its modernization after World War One, and with the assistance of German technicians developed a copy of the German 8mm S cartridge. Most of the surplus […]

South African Army .22 Rimfire Conversion for the R4

January 18, 2019 Ian McCollum 13
In order to allow cheaper and simpler training of troops, the South African Defense Forces adopted a .22 rimfire conversion kit for their R4 rifles. The system was developed by an engineer named Willie Klotz […]
